The Los AngelesTelluride run covers 560 nautical miles, typically flown on a midsize jet in about 1h 43m block time from KVNY to KTEX.

Telluride peaks Dec–Mar, Jun–Aug — strongest demand around winter and summer. Book 2–4 weeks ahead in season; slots and ramp space at KTEX tighten around holidays and major events.

How long is the flight from Los Angeles to Telluride?

The trip covers about 560 nautical miles. Plan on roughly 1h 43m block time on a midsize jet — a light jet runs about 1h 45m, a heavy jet about 1h 37m. Block time includes taxi and climb, not just cruise.

How much does a private jet from Los Angeles to Telluride cost?

One-way estimates run $17,000–$24,000 on a midsize jet, the class most travelers book at this distance. Across the whole rate card the spread is $7,500 (turboprop) to $38,500 (heavy jet). Real quotes move with dates, positioning, and demand.

Which airports do private jets use between Los Angeles and Telluride?

Departures typically use KVNY, KBUR, KLAX; arrivals use KTEX, KMTJ, KGJT. When KTEX is slot-restricted or weathered in, nearby alternates include KDRO, KCEZ, KGUC, KFMN.

What size aircraft is right for Los Angeles to Telluride?

At 560 nm, most charters book a midsize jet (Citation XLS+, Learjet 60XR, 7–9 seats). Larger cabins fly it faster with more room; smaller classes trade comfort for price.
